We issued our first $1.5 billion green bond in February 2016 and our second $1 billion green bond in June 2017 to help advance projects to mitigate our impact on climate change and inspire others to do the same. Bond prices fluctuate, although they tend to be less volatile than stocks. Some bonds, particularly U.S. Treasury securities, come with relatively lower risks and can help preserve capital and potentially generate income. When interest rates rise, bond prices tend to fall, and vice versa. FINRA’s Fixed …Here, it is the coupon rate of 2.25% times the par value of the bond. Some varieties are especially suitable for cold climates and others for warm climates. All apple trees require a certain number of “chill hours” every year—temperatures between 32 and 45 degrees Fahrenheit.
